I thin kyou will find its the clutch plate not the pressure plate
The torsional damping springs in the clutch plate some times become a little weak and thus the rattle
You can replace the plate with one that has stronger springs or do what I would do and just leave it until a clutch replacement is necessary.
If your unsure get it checked out at a clutch specialist rather than your local mech
